Design and Application of Fiber-Bragg-Grating Strain Tube

    A fiber Bragg grating (FBG) strain tube, which is fabricated by affixing bare fiber grating to a strain tube, is designed to solve existing problems in deep displacement monitoring of pipeline landslide. Strain measurement principle of fiber Bragg grating and deep displacement calculation method of landslide measured by FBG strain tube are presented. According to results of performance test, strain sensitive coefficient of a FBG strain tube is 0.58 pm/10-6. According to field trials, measurement results of FBG strain tube are mostly agreeable with these of declinometer.
